Basil White Bean Dip

This fabulous dip is awesome with fresh, chilled veggies like red peppers, cucumbers and celery.

    Ingredients

    • 1 cup fresh chopped basil
    • 1 15 oz can white beans, drained and rinsed
    • 1/4 cup extra virgin olive oil
    • 2 tbsp grated parmesan cheese
    • sea salt and pepper

    Directions

    1. 1In the bowl of a food processor (a mini one works great for this!), combine the basil, white beans, olive oil and parmesan. Salt and pepper to taste.
    2. 2Whirl the mixture in the food processor until smooth.
    3. 3Serve with fresh veggies.
